Transaction 5ef33a9479e9418df4237cea172ac027250c3dc671e140e673041a1f5a5a8c15

1 Input
2 Outputs
  • 5ef33a9479e9418df4237cea172ac027250c3dc671e140e673041a1f5a5a8c15:0
  • value  1717695
    address  37W8dXmJG8ZodCXtv5617UbVuK8T18V5sJ
  • 5ef33a9479e9418df4237cea172ac027250c3dc671e140e673041a1f5a5a8c15:1
  • value  54568564
    address  1CWv1RmjDUJYVyQUhnXgFwSZNGodgMVxEb